Preview
Hyderabad come into this after a 1-1 draw vs Jamshedpur in their previous ISL clash on Thursday.
Stewart and Ogbeche scored for either side in either half to secure a stalemate, which was their first draw of the season.
After 3 matches, Hyderabad has picked up 4 points and aren’t playing their best football as yet but looking to gain more confidence.
A victory is needed to boost their good start to the season.
On the other hand, Bengaluru lost 3-1 to Mumbai City FC on Saturday in their previous clash.

Angulo, Fali and Ygor scored the goals for Mumbai while Silva’s strike was the sole one for Bengaluru, which proved inconsequential.
A second loss of the season keeps them in 8th place with 4 points as well, but the visitors need to turn the tide quick.
Both sides last met in the ISL 2020-21 season in January, where it finished 2-2 which marked successive draws home and away.

Team News
Narzary and Yasir miss out for Hyderabad due to injuries at this point.
Ibara left the field early vs Mumbai nursing an injury and could miss out for Bengaluru here.
